distinguish用法(一)

不同形式和用法的”distinguish”

1. 动词: - Distinguish A from B: 将A与B区分开来 - 例如:

It’s difficult to distinguish her twin sister from her. -

Distinguish oneself: 表现出色,使自己脱颖而出 - 例如:He

distinguished himself as an outstanding musician at a young

age.

2. 名词: - Distinguishing feature/characteristic: 特征,

特点 - 例如:Her long, curly hair is her most distinguishing

feature. - Distinguished person: 杰出人物,显赫人物 - 例如:

The event was attended by many distinguished guests.

3. 形容词:“distinguished”作为形容词是指杰出的、受人尊

敬的、卓越的 - 例如:He is a distinguished professor at the

university.

补充说明

• Distinguish between A and B: 区分A和B。与”Distinguish

A from B”相似,但在句子结构上稍有不同。这种用法常用于表

示能够区分两个或多个物体、概念或情况。

• Distinguish yourself: 在特定领域或活动中表现出色。这种用

法通常用于工作、比赛或其他竞争性环境中,指某人通过出色的

表现与其他人区分开来。

例句: - Can you distinguish between the two kinds of

birds by their songs? - The athlete distinguished himself in

the Olympic Games. - The distinguishing characteristic of

this breed of dog is its curly tail. - The event was attended

by a group of distinguished scholars.
